On June 12, 2026, David Kenny purchased 4,330 shares of Best Buy Co., Inc. (NYSE: BBY). This insider transaction did not involve a pre-planned trading arrangement and reflects a direct purchase of shares.
Insider Buying and Selling at Best Buy Co., Inc.
David Kenny was not the only insider involved in transactions on June 12. Sima Sistani, David Kimbell, Karen McLoughlin, Mario Jesus Marte, and Steven Rendle each acquired 2,611 shares. These purchases were also not part of any pre-planned trading scheme.
Other Institutional Activity in Best Buy
Several institutional investors adjusted their positions in Best Buy. BlackRock, Inc. trimmed its holdings by 641,949 shares, ending with 25.4 million shares valued at about $1.63 billion. State Street Corp reduced its stake by 88,888 shares, holding 13.2 million shares worth $857.1 million. Geode Capital Management, LLC increased its position by 2.49 million shares, now holding 7.69 million shares valued at $501.7 million. Vanguard Capital Management LLC and Vanguard Portfolio Management LLC both established new positions, each holding 12.8 million and 9.77 million shares, respectively.

Earnings Call Summary
Best Buy delivered 9.4 billion dollars in second quarter sales, up 1.6 percent, driven by strong Switch 2 launch, six straight quarters of computing growth hitting highest laptop volumes in 15 years, and gaming momentum. They launched their marketplace offering six times more products online and are expanding vendor partnerships, including a new one with IKEA for kitchen and appliance displays. Cost pressures from tariffs remained manageable at below the effective tariff rate due to supply chain mitigation.
Guidance Best Buy kept its full year sales guidance of 41.1 billion to 41.9 billion dollars and earnings per share of 6.15 to 6.30 dollars. Management said they expect to hit the higher end of their sales range. They also expect gaming and computing to keep growing in the back half, with new phone launches and Windows 11 upgrades helping momentum.

About Best Buy Co., Inc.
Best Buy Co., Inc. is a leading specialty retailer in the consumer cyclical sector. Based in Richfield, Minnesota, the company offers a wide range of technology products and services across the United States, Canada, and internationally. Its offerings include computing devices, mobile phones, consumer electronics, and home appliances. Best Buy is managed by CEO Corie Sue Barry and employs around 82,000 people.
